Meaning
Toluene derivatives are chemical compounds that are derived from toluene, a hydrocarbon with the chemical formula C7H8. Toluene itself is produced during the process of refining crude oil or through the conversion of coal tar. Toluene derivatives are created by modifying the chemical structure of toluene through various processes, resulting in a wide range of useful compounds with diverse applications.

Category-wise Insights
- Benzene: Benzene, a key toluene derivative, is primarily used as a raw material in the production of various chemicals. It finds extensive application in the manufacturing of plastics, resins, synthetic fibers, and rubber. Benzene derivatives, such as ethylbenzene and styrene, have significant demand in the automotive and construction industries.
- Xylene: Xylene, another important toluene derivative, is utilized as a solvent and as a raw material in the production of polymers, resins, and coatings. It finds application in industries such as paints and coatings, textiles, and pharmaceuticals. Ortho-xylene, meta-xylene, and para-xylene are the three isomers of xylene, each having distinct properties and applications.
- Toluene Diisocyanate (TDI): TDI is a critical toluene derivative used in the production of flexible polyurethane foams, coatings, adhesives, and sealants. The increasing demand for lightweight materials in automotive and construction sectors drives the demand for TDI.
- Benzyl Chloride: Benzyl chloride is primarily used as an intermediate in the production of dyes, perfumes, pharmaceuticals, and resins. It finds application as a catalyst and solvent in various chemical reactions.
- Benzoic Acid: Benzoic acid, derived from toluene, is extensively used as a preservative in the food and beverage industry. It also finds applications in the production of pharmaceuticals, plastics, and animal feed additives.
